FCC to eliminate gigabit speed goal and scrap analysis of broadband prices

As part of our return to following the plain language of section 706, we propose to abolish without replacement the long-term goal of 1,000/500Mbps established in the 2024 Report. Not only is a long-term goal not mentioned in section 706, but maintaining such a goal risks skewing the market by unnecessarily potentially picking technological winners and losers.

Global broadband growth slows at end of 2024 | Computer Weekly

In its Q4 2024 update, global fixed broadband connections reached 1.5 billion with a quarterly growth of 0.91%, down from 1.44% in Q3 2024.
